Amanda Hope Day, 46, of Wise Virginia has gone home to be with the Lord and is currently touring her awesome heavenly home. She completed her mission here on earth on Sunday, May 17, 2026.

Amanda is the daughter of the late Loretta Sturgill and Glen Allen Day.

Amanda was born and raised in Dunbar, Virginia surrounded by siblings, cousins and friends. She spent the majority of her adult years living in Wise, Virginia. She dedicated her life to loving the least of these in both human and animal form.

She served her community and those away from home as an RN. During her 25-year career, she worked at various hospitals and nursing facilities both locally and as a travel nurse. She genuinely loved her patients. Although Amanda had a deep love for people and the dozens of little animals she rescued throughout her life, her greatest love and achievement was being a Mom and was the foundation to everything she did.

Manda - Loved the outdoors, camping, and lazy days by the lake. She also loved laughing at silly videos, close family gatherings around the campfire, car rides with good tunes, and meteor showers.

She is survived by her beautiful daughter, Liberty Thacker of Wise, VA; her 5 sisters, Michelle, Faith, Suzanne, Mary and Al'lea; her 9 nieces and nephews, Sierra, Hailea, Sadie, Lanie, Addi, Zoe, Samuel, Kaleah, and her beloved baby nephew Simon; step-father, Paul Sturgill; step-siblings, Paul & Paula; Her extended family included a pack of furry family members, in addition to her own devoted pup Daisy, and her kitties, Tubby, Mavi, and Tigger.

Per her request, she wants everyone to know the cancer has been defeated and she is living it up in Heaven and is now Mom's new favorite. Nothing in life is more important than Jesus!

She was an amazing human being and to the people who knew her, our lives are better because she existed and we thank God for her life and light. Skininininnin, Sister. ❤️

Funeral services for Amanda Day will be conducted at 11:00 A.M. Saturday, May 23, 2026 at the Esserville Community Church in Norton, VA. Family will receive friends from 10:00 A.M. till time of services at 11:00 A.M. on Saturday at the church.
